Eye Spy
The secret to successful
marketing of specialty and value added products is listening and watching
for clues which tell us what the customer wants and values. Be a marketing
detective. The next time you travel to another part of the country,
particularly larger cities or urban areas, go shopping for ideas.
Go into specialty stores. Those in large airports are good examples.
Search for clues for potential product and marketing opportunities.
1. Look at the products
on the shelves. What products could have been made in North Dakota
with North Dakota products or resources?
2. Talk to a sales clerk
or store manager. Ask them what kinds of products sell best. (Make
notes.) Ask them what kinds of products they would like to have more
of or have difficulty getting.
3. Read the specialty gift
catalogs you receive in the mail. Observe what kinds of products they
carry, how they are packaged and what words and pictures are used
to capture your attention. Could products similar, but more distinctive,
be developed and produced here in North Dakota?
